Right now I'm listening to Rachmaninoff's 2nd piano concerto for about the 50th time :-) and I notice a lot of what attracts me is the emotions it allows me to experience: excitement, intensity, resolution!, meaningfulness, presentness in the moment, love-like feelings.....and it's a kind of exchange with some[one]thing else.

I guess for me it's like having pets. Music has always kept me company since I was a kid, and I always liked very complicated/sophisticated music while all my peers were listening to the top ten hits. So this was one more way to set me apart from them. When I was about 5, I remember hiding in a corner with a transitor radio I got for my birthday (this is 1957) with the volume on low and the radio pressed to my ear, and listening to Beethoven--not popular with my brothers and sisters (although my mom like Chopin, which was good).
